USB Drive Connection

Short story.. in-laws have 3500L and went to a larger USB drive, the stock firmware doesn't see it so I decided to upgrade to DD-WRT.  

I flashed : DDWRT Kong Mod USB/FTP/SAMBA3/...  Build 22000+

When I connect the drive, it says:  ... mounted to /tmp/mnt/disk0-part1

Settings:

  • Core USB, USB Storage, Automatic Mount enabled, no script and nothing in the mount for /jffs or /opt
  • Samba enabled
  • Sever String (empty), Workgroup name : set to what I have thier PC's to
  • Share.. well, the pull down doesn't have the mount point (see below)
  • Name set, pulbic and RW

But when I go to the sharing tab, I try to setup a share but the pulldown only shows -, dev, mnt.   I am only partially unix savy, but in reading I thought that mnt was linked to tmp/mnt, but I don't see any contents of the drive in windows.  I see the share, but it is empty and when I try to create a file it will not let me.  However I should see my files at least which leads me to think I am not looking at the drive yet!

Any assistance would be appreciated!
